Red Wings vs Capitals prediction

My best bet: Tom Wilson anytime goal (+210 at FanDuel)

My analysis
Washington Capitals forward Tom Wilson’s impressive offensive stretch over the past two months coincides with the Detroit Red Wings’ recent defensive woes. Over that same stretch, Detroit ranks 22nd in the league in xGA/60.

Backing up this defensively poor team is goaltender Petr Mrazek, who has surrendered three or more goals in 16 of his last 19 starts. Mrazek is 5-12-1 over that stretch with a .875 SV% and 3.95 GAA.

Meanwhile, Wilson presents a threat to score at both even strength and on the power play, given that he leads the Capitals in goals on the man-advantage. This presents a particularly advantageous opportunity against the Red Wings, as they rank last in penalty-kill percentage.

Washington's offense has been humming in recent games, too, scoring four or more goals in four of their last five, with the lone exception coming in a shutout loss vs. the Kings' elite defense.

Wilson scored in the last meeting between these two teams a couple of weeks ago, and considering the aforementioned variables, I like him to find the back of the net again this evening.

Red Wings vs Capitals same-game parlay (SGP)

Tom Wilson anytime goal

Dylan Strome 1+ assists

Capitals moneyline

If we are backing Wilson to find the back of the net, then there is an increased probability of Dylan Strome recording an assist. The primary facilitator on the team, Strome skates alongside Wilson on both the first line and the top power-play unit. Plus, Strome has assisted on two of Wilson’s last three goals.

If they both contribute offensively, Washington’s chances of winning increase. Washington is the stronger team and has won three of the last four meetings between these two clubs.
